    Last week we heard how John positioned the baptism of Jesus in the context of the prophetic role of John the Baptist. And in that account the first disciples of Jesus were previously disciples of John the Baptist – no mention of them being fishermen picked up along the beach.  Matthew goes with the fisherman version of the story, although he misses the great line about becoming fishers of men (Matthew 4:12-23). Matthew doesn’t seem to be drawn to such flourishes.
